Windows 98 should run. It isn't supported but that just means help from MS, not whether or not it will run. There are many Win98SE offerings on eBay. Don't buy an upgrade edition. You won't be able to install it without an earlier version to upgrade. Buy what's called a full edition.

I have Virtual PC 7.0.3 on my iMac G5 (PPC) running OS X 10.4.11, and I run
Windows XP Professional within VPC.
I have a language CD that I used to run on a Windows PC which needs Windows
95, 98 or NT 4.0. I uninstalled it from the old PC some time ago when I
sold
it, and have recently tried to install it on this version of XP but without
success.
Can I install Windows 98 SE on my VPC in addition to XP?
I don't see a supported Win98 solution for you on the G5 and Tiger X.4.
Win98 is supported on Parallels, but you need an Intel Mac to run
Parallels.
VPC 6 supports Windows 98, but it doesn't run on the G5 and probably
won't run on Tiger.
http://support.microsoft.com/kb/827904
Of course you could always give VPC7 & Win98 a try, the FAQ below says
there may be some limitations.
